Ruihua Lu is a scholar working on Transportation, Ocean Engineering and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Ruihua Lu has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 441 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Transportation, 4 papers in Ocean Engineering and 4 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Ruihua Lu's work include Transportation Planning and Optimization (5 papers), Maritime Transport Emissions and Efficiency (4 papers) and Ship Hydrodynamics and Maneuverability (3 papers). Ruihua Lu is often cited by papers focused on Transportation Planning and Optimization (5 papers), Maritime Transport Emissions and Efficiency (4 papers) and Ship Hydrodynamics and Maneuverability (3 papers). Ruihua Lu collaborates with scholars based in China, Netherlands and Sweden. Ruihua Lu's co-authors include Jonas W. Ringsberg, Jiang He, Lizhen Huang, Osman Turan, Evangelos Boulougouris, Charlotte Banks, Atilla İncecik, Xiaoyan Du, Jie Zhu and Feng‐Ming Qi and has published in prestigious journals such as Applied Surface Science, Spectrochimica Acta Part A Molecular and Biomolecular Spectroscopy and Bioorganic & Medicinal Chemistry Letters.
